Overview
Under the direction of the Institute for Cancer leadership, this position is accountable for providing individualized assistance to those newly diagnosed with cancer and patients in active treatment for cancer Cancer Nurse Navigator assesses patient needs upon initial encounter and periodically throughout navigation, matching unmet needs with appropriate services and referrals and support services. This nurse identifies potential and realized barriers to care and facilitates referrals as appropriate to mitigate barriers.
By participating in coordination of the plan of care with the multidisciplinary team she applies knowledge of clinical guidelines to assist the patient and family throughout the cancer continuum.
- Assess patient needs at initial encounter and periodically throughout navigation.
- Match unmet needs with appropriate services, referrals, and support services.
- Identify potential and realized barriers to care and facilitate referrals to mitigate barriers.
- Coordinate the plan of care with the multidisciplinary team and apply clinical guidelines to assist the patient and family throughout the cancer continuum.
- Collaborate with cancer program administration and cancer committee to develop strategies to meet the requirements and standards of the American College of Surgeons Commission on Cancer, NAPBC, and related committees as applicable for the disease specialty served.
- Assist in development and performance of specialty service educational activities and program evaluation.
- Support the hospital's community needs related to cancer education, screening, and prevention, and contribute to improving the care experience of the cancer patient and their family.
- Other duties as requested.
